Little Rock police say a toddler’s fall from a hotel balcony appears to have been an accident.
Officers say 1-year-old Braylon Halton was hurt while he was at the Super 7 Motel on Interstate 30 Monday night.
KLRT-TV reports that investigators say Braylon and his mother, Arlesha Arnold, were on the balcony with another person when Braylon leaned against the balcony’s railing and it broke.
Braylon tumbled off the balcony and landed head-first onto the pavement. The child was taken to Arkansas Children’s Hospital, where he was treated for a fractured skull and bleeding.
Officers say no charges have been filed.
